js实现悬浮放大画册图片墙效果代码
代码语言:html
所属分类:画廊相册
代码描述:js实现悬浮放大画册图片墙效果代码
下面为部分代码预览,完整代码请点击下载或在bfwstudio webide中打开
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d"> <html> <head> <style type="text/css"> body { background: #222; overflow: hidden; left: 0; top: 0; width: 100%; height: 100%; margin: 0; padding: 0; } #screen span { position:absolute; overflow:hidden; border:#FFF solid 1px; background:#FFF; } #screen img{ position:absolute; left:-32px; top:-32px; cursor: pointer; } #caption, #title{ color: #FFF; font-family: georgia, 'times new roman', times, veronica, serif; font-size: 1em; text-align: center; } #caption b { font-size: 2em; } </style> <script type="text/javascript"> <!-- window.onerror = new Function("return true"); var obj = []; var scr; var spa; var img; var W; var Wi; var Hi; var wi; var hi; var Sx; var Sy; var M; var xm; var ym; var xb = 0; var yb = 0; var ob = - 1; var cl = false; /* needed in standard mode */ px = function(x) { return Math.round(x) + "px"; } /* center image - do not resize for perf. reason */ img_center = function(o) { with(img[o]) { style.left = px( - (width - Wi) / 2); style.top = px( - (height - Hi) / 2).........完整代码请登录后点击上方下载按钮下载查看
网友评论0